What to Anticipate Throughout Your First Plumbing Service Call
Scheduling your first plumbing service call can really feel a little uncertain, particularly in the event you’re not familiar with how the process works. Whether or not you’re dealing with a leaking faucet, clogged drains, or a bigger concern like low water pressure, knowing what to expect can help you're feeling more prepared and confident. Professional plumbers comply with a transparent process designed to establish the problem, clarify solutions, and complete the work efficiently. Right here’s a breakdown of what often happens throughout that first service visit.
Initial Contact and Scheduling
Before the plumber even arrives, the process starts with scheduling. If you call the plumbing firm, the representative will usually ask for particulars about your issue. They might wish to know how long you’ve seen the problem, what signs you’ve observed (like strange noises in your pipes or water pooling in certain areas), and whether or not it’s an urgent situation. Based mostly on this information, they’ll provide you with an estimated timeframe for when a plumber can come to your home.
Many firms additionally provide a service window quite than a precise time, since plumbing jobs can differ in length. It’s best to plan your day with some flexibility in mind.
Arrival and Introduction
When the plumber arrives, they will introduce themselves and confirm the main points of your appointment. Reputable plumbers usually wear uniforms, carry identification, and arrive in clearly marked service vehicles. This step ensures you know you’re dealing with a professional. They could additionally take a couple of minutes to go over any paperwork, corresponding to service agreements or commonplace pricing information, before beginning their assessment.
Initial Assessment of the Problem
The plumber’s first task is to evaluate the issue you reported. This typically includes asking you a couple of more detailed questions and then inspecting the problem space directly. For instance, for those who called a few slow-draining sink, they may check the trap, look under the cabinet for leaks, and test the water flow. If your water heater isn’t functioning, they’ll look at the unit, its connections, and the surrounding plumbing system.
Plumbers often use specialized tools like video inspection cameras for drains or pressure gauges for water systems. This assessment helps them establish each the immediate subject and any undermendacity causes.
Clarification and Estimate
As soon as the problem is identified, the plumber will clarify what’s happening in clear, easy-to-understand terms. They’ll outline potential options and provide an estimate for the repair or replacement work. This is your opportunity to ask questions—reminiscent of how long the repair will take, whether there are different solutions, and what kind of warranty or guarantee is offered.
A superb plumber will be upfront about costs and keep away from hidden fees. You’ll typically be asked to approve the estimate earlier than any repair work begins.
Performing the Work
After you’ve agreed to the proposed resolution, the plumber will begin the repair. Depending on the complicatedity of the job, this may take wherever from a few minutes to several hours. For simple points like replacing a faucet washer or clearing a minor clog, the fix is usually quick. Bigger jobs, reminiscent of repairing broken pipes or changing water heaters, may take longer and could require observe-up visits.
In the course of the work, the plumber will use protective measures to keep your home clean. This often includes wearing shoe covers, utilizing drop cloths, or cleaning up any mess created during the repair.
Testing and Verification
Once the repair is full, the plumber will test the system to make sure everything is working properly. They might run water through the pipes, check for leaks, or monitor water pressure. This step ensures the problem is absolutely resolved earlier than they leave.
Wrap-Up and Next Steps
At the end of the visit, the plumber will evaluation the work accomplished and go over any important information you should know. This would possibly embrace upkeep suggestions, signs to observe for sooner or later, or recommendations for additional services if they seen different issues. You’ll additionally receive an in depth invoice outlining the labor, parts used, and total cost.
Peace of Mind for the Future
Your first plumbing service call sets the tone for how you’ll handle household issues moving forward. By understanding the process—from scheduling and assessment to repair and observe-up—you'll be able to approach the situation with less stress. The goal of any professional plumber is just not only to fix the rapid problem but additionally to provide long-term peace of mind that your home’s plumbing system is functioning safely and efficiently.
